Current Employee3.3Oct 31, 2024Vention is okay. Lots of good things. Some bad is creeping in. Time will tell
Current Employee3.4Mar 27, 2024Overall solid company. Experiencing a rough market but has been around for 20+ years
Former Employee1.4Jan 11, 2024My experience was not great. They are not resistant to market slow downs and do not pay well or incentivize enough to make it worth it. Management was not equipped to lead a team or know where to go.
My experience was not great. They are not resistant to market slow downs and do not pay well or incentivize enough to make it worth it. Management was not equipped to lead a team or know where to go.
Current Employee4.6Aug 29, 2023Solid pay plan. Get to hunt and farm. Runs like a startup in good and bad ways.